Fault Handlers only working on global XFire Singleton.   Ignored on service 
handlers.

Ok, so here's an update.  I got my services to work in both secure and
insecure mode (that is some services are published as secure, other
insecure -- not one service as both).  I did this by using the handlers
on the Service objects rather than the global XFire object.  Makes sense.

Here's my problem now:  Faults only seem to work from the global XFire
object.  So when a fault occurs, it doesn't appear that the framework
will look at the Service's handlers to handle the fault on a service by
service basis, but rather the XFire fault handlers only and since not
all services are secured, I get exceptions when wss4j headers are
expected in some cases, but not others.

I verified this by adding a secure handler to the Global XFire fault
handler, caused a fault in the insecure service and got a prolog eof
exception because the wss4j headers were missing.  Then tried a secure
fault and got the real fault back in the client which is what was
expected.  Flipped the scenario and got the exact opposite results.

So, what I need is the framework to use the service fault handlers when
a fault occurs (when they are registered, of course) rather than the
global handlers.

I think this is in the DefaultEndpoint class, around line 70 in the
catch block when the fault is created and piped through.
